The Army Contracting Command - New Jersey is seeking qualified small businesses to provide snow and ice removal services at two locations in New York: NY001 MAJ James J. ODonovan AFRC at 90 North Main Avenue, Albany, NY 12203-1411 and NY059 AMSA # 8 G at 101 Remsen Street, Schenectady, NY 12306-2811. The work must ensure clean, safe workplaces by removing snow and ice in accordance with the detailed Performance Work Statement, with services required to meet established standards for timing, equipment use, and operational safety. This solicitation is a total small business set-aside under FAR 19.5, meaning only small businesses certified by the SBA are eligible to respond. The North American Industry Classification System code for this procurement is 561790, classifying it under Other Services Related to Building Activities. The solicitation, identified as W15QKN26QA135, was posted on July 13, 2026, and proposals must be submitted by 2:00 PM Eastern Time on July 24, 2026. The contracting office is located at Picatinny Arsenal, New Jersey, under the Department of Defense, and the point of contact for inquiries is Ryan Nicklous, with Theresa Eckstein as the secondary contact. The Army Contracting Command - New Jersey (ACC-NJ) on behalf of the 99th Readiness Division DPW has a requirement to procure new Snow and Ice Removal Services. The scope of this requirement is to provide a clean workplace free of snow and ice in accordance with the Performance Work Statement at NY001 MAJ James J. ODonovan AFRC located at 90 North Main Avenue, Albany, NY 12203-1411 and NY059 AMSA # 8 (G) located at 101 Remsen Street, Schenectady, NY 12306-2811.

The United States Army Contracting Command – New Jersey, on behalf of Project Manager – Combat Ammunition Systems, is conducting a market survey to identify qualified vendors capable of providing 155mm propelling charges and percussion primers alongside comprehensive engineering services to support the evaluation of propulsion systems for the Mobile Tactical Cannon, a 52-caliber howitzer. The assessment will be conducted using a 23-liter chamber configuration as the test platform since the final MTC design remains undetermined. Vendors must submit detailed technical data on their propulsion solutions, including formulation details for propellant, ignitors, and cases, along with performance predictions based on modeling and simulation for key parameters such as muzzle velocity, maximum operating pressure, temperature sensitivity, and gun tube wear, all aligned with NATO STANAG 4110 and STANAG 4224 standards. Responses must demonstrate technology and manufacturing readiness levels, prior experience in artillery ammunition testing, and the availability of existing hardware for U.S. compatibility assessments. In addition to hardware deliverables, vendors are required to outline their capacity to provide engineering services including modeling and simulation, pre-live-fire safety planning, and live-fire test execution spanning six to ten weeks, likely at Yuma Proving Ground in FY27. Vendors must also provide lead-time estimates for hardware delivery and personnel availability, factoring in manufacturing, logistics to YPG, and any long-lead activities tied to prototype development for U.S. fuzed projectiles. A critical requirement is disclosure of existing or planned manufacturing capacity for supercharge technologies, which will inform long-term contracting decisions. All submissions must include signed DD Form 2345, AMSTA-AR Form 1350, and a Non-Disclosure Agreement to access controlled technical data, with compliance to ITAR regulations mandatory.
